Irish Paracyclists end season in style.

The Irish Paracycling Squad finished their 2010 International campaign in style in UCI P1 Paracycling Track competition in Kaarst, Germany over the weekend capturing two gold, one silver, two bronze medal wins and a number of top ten finishes into the bargain.

Ireland’s Cerebral Palsy Football Team win bronze medal at European Championship

Ireland completed an incredible two weeks at the CP-ISRA European Championships in Glasgow on Friday when they beat a strong Dutch team in the bronze medal play-off match.

Ireland v’s Ukraine - European Championships Glasgow

On Friday last the 20th August Ireland played their third game in four days at these European championships when they faced the current Paralympic champions, Ukraine. Ireland produced a structured and controlled first half creating a number of chances but failed to break a strong Ukraine defence

Brilliant Gold Medal win for Mark Rohan at UCI Paracycling World Road Championships in Canada

Athlone athlete Mark Rohan secured Ireland’s first ever Paracycling World Championship Gold Medal when winning the H1 Handcycling Road Race in Baie-Comeau Canada today.

Madsen wins National Development Boccia Championships 2010

The First National Development Boccia Championships was held on the 18th August in Ballinteer Community School with 8 Athletes selected to compete. Throughout the year, teams of Boccia Players competed together in the national League championships.
